Abbott is an American healthcare company founded in 1888 by a Chicago physician who began making precise doses of alkaloid medicines for his own patients. It now operates four large businesses: diagnostics, including the point-of-care and molecular testing that scaled during the pandemic, medical devices spanning cardiac rhythm, structural heart, neuromodulation and continuous glucose monitoring, nutrition brands such as Similac and Ensure, and established pharmaceuticals sold mainly in emerging markets. The company is headquartered in North Chicago, Illinois, and separated its research-based drug business as AbbVie in 2013.

JOB DESCRIPTION:
The Opportunity:
Organize and conduct, or participate in, all performance evaluations for new products, product enhancements, and product process changes. Participate as the clinical resource on product development teams, working with R&D, Regulatory Affairs, Quality Assurance and Marketing in identifying user needs and market segments, and presenting relevant evaluation results as necessary.
What you’ll do:
- Provide clinical knowledge and expertise in clinical study protocol development, clinical trial design, analysis and interpretation
- Solid performance in creating high quality, scientifically sound and medically accurate documents that are clear and focused for clinical research and regulatory agency submissions (such as FDA).
- Expertise with health care and medical communication and effective use of on-line research databases, such as Pubmed, and use of integrated referencing software.
- Evaluates new product ideas and business opportunities by reviewing pertinent literature and other available information, summarizing information and making recommendations to appropriate departments.
- Scientific review and input to CRF development. Excellent collaboration skills with biostatistics and data management.
- Participates in the Risk Analysis process for new or improved devices to ensure that potential risks to patients associated with use of the device and risks to study execution are identified and appropriately analyzed.
- Creates clinical performance evaluation plans to assess physician acceptance and the expected performance of new products by interacting with appropriate personnel, (e.g., physicians, engineers, other clinical coordinators, regulatory affairs).
- Cultivates relationships with internal and external customers, (e.g., consultants and investigators) to continue to grow their expertise in clinical research.
- Writes device Instructions for Use (IFU).
- Provide clinical knowledge, expertise and direction relevant to manufacturing, quality, performance and patient safety during all phases of development of a product or concepts to ensure informed decisions are made in these areas.
- Support product development by contributing clinical knowledge to bench testing, performing in-vitro and /or in-vivo device evaluations and assisting in the development of new test methods to provide a better understanding of device performance.
- Coordinate and conduct post-market clinical evaluations of new product designs or enhancements.
- Participates in Product Action process by performing and documenting a Health Risk Assessment and communicating the assessment to Quality Assurance.
